I'm not goth, I've never quite gotten into it.
I'm a metallist, though, and goth culture is somewhat close to my heart. This is why I get so mad every time I hear something like this. We all know how metal bands (and metal / goth / other subcultures) are constantly blamed for being evil, satanic, etc...
In Finland we have only one festival totally dedicated to metal music - Tuska ('Pain'). Of course, some religious (and other...) loonies are all the time preaching about it being evil - last year there were some people with banderolls saying "Satan has come to Helsinki!" outside the festival area... and there was one "document" (well, wasn't very documentary, some marginal media bullsh!t) labeling it as the "festival of blood, violence and evil".
In reality, Tuska has been arranged 4 times so far (5th this summer), and yet (to my knowledge) not a single crime of violence, crime against property or drug offense has been reported. And every year we've received praise from the local police for peaceful festivals. This is extraordinary. Well, I saw one act of violence there last year; Some loonie (one of the banderoll-people) threw a bucket of water on a metalhead who just happened to pass by. So much for the christian tolerance...
